I stood by your side whenever you wished for it.
I never realized that I never asked you of anything.
I never realized that doing something for you was enough to make me smile.
You took me for granted because I was kind to you unconditionally.
I guess that was my downfall.
I needed you once.
You gave me excuses.
I never knew this side of you
You stabbed me hard with your hurtful words.
Then truth was revealed.
You already let go of me because I was no longer needed.
You already stepped on me like I was the grass.
You were far beyond my reach.
I was taken advantage of.
And then you think that's over for me.
But you're wrong.
I'll once again rise, wiser than I was before, shine brighter than I was before, and most of all stronger than I've ever been.
Yeah that's right.
Because the spring always comes after the winter.
